DBA Data[Home] [Help]

PACKAGE: APPS.CN_QUOTAS_PKG

Source


1 PACKAGE cn_quotas_pkg AS
2 /* $Header: cnpliqos.pls 120.1.12000000.3 2007/10/09 20:17:54 rnagired ship $ */
3      --
4      --+
5      -- Purpose
6      --+
7      -- Notes
8      -- Called  for Insert/Update/delete
9      --+
10    PROCEDURE begin_record (
11       x_operation                         VARCHAR2,
12       x_rowid                    IN OUT NOCOPY VARCHAR2,
13       x_quota_id                 IN OUT NOCOPY NUMBER,
14       x_object_version_number    OUT NOCOPY NUMBER,
15       x_name                              VARCHAR2,
16       x_target                            NUMBER,
17       x_quota_type_code                   VARCHAR2,
18       x_period_type_code                  VARCHAR2,
19       x_usage_code                        VARCHAR2,
20       x_payment_amount                    NUMBER,
21       x_description                       VARCHAR2,
22       x_start_date                        DATE,
23       x_end_date                          DATE,
24       x_quota_status                      VARCHAR2,
25       x_start_num                         NUMBER,
26       x_end_num                           NUMBER,
27       x_program_type                      VARCHAR2,
28       --x_status_code   varchar2 ,
29       x_last_update_date                  DATE,
30       x_last_updated_by                   NUMBER,
31       x_creation_date                     DATE,
32       x_created_by                        NUMBER,
33       x_last_update_login                 NUMBER,
34       x_incentive_type_code               VARCHAR2,
35       x_credit_type_id                    NUMBER,
36       x_calc_formula_id                   NUMBER,
37       x_rt_sched_custom_flag              VARCHAR2,
38       x_package_name                      VARCHAR2,
39       x_performance_goal                  NUMBER,
40       x_interval_type_id                  NUMBER,
41       x_payee_assign_flag                 VARCHAR2,
42       x_vesting_flag                      VARCHAR2,
43       x_quota_unspecified                 NUMBER,
44       x_addup_from_rev_class_flag         VARCHAR2,
45       x_expense_account_id                NUMBER,
46       x_liability_account_id              NUMBER,
47       x_quota_group_code                  VARCHAR2,
48       --clku payment enhancement
49       x_payment_group_code                VARCHAR2 := 'STANDARD',
50       --clku, bug 2854576
51       x_attribute_category                VARCHAR2 := NULL,
52       x_attribute1                        VARCHAR2,
53       x_attribute2                        VARCHAR2,
54       x_attribute3                        VARCHAR2,
55       x_attribute4                        VARCHAR2,
56       x_attribute5                        VARCHAR2,
57       x_attribute6                        VARCHAR2,
58       x_attribute7                        VARCHAR2,
59       x_attribute8                        VARCHAR2,
60       x_attribute9                        VARCHAR2,
61       x_attribute10                       VARCHAR2,
62       x_attribute11                       VARCHAR2,
63       x_attribute12                       VARCHAR2,
64       x_attribute13                       VARCHAR2,
65       x_attribute14                       VARCHAR2,
66       x_attribute15                       VARCHAR2,
67       -- fmburu r12
68       x_indirect_credit                   VARCHAR2,
69       x_org_id                            NUMBER,
70       x_salesrep_end_flag                 VARCHAR2
71    );
72 
73    --  temp use
74    PROCEDURE UPDATE_RECORD (
75       x_quota_id                          NUMBER,
76       x_start_date                        DATE,
77       x_end_date                          DATE
78    );
79 
80    --  Must be public as called by cn_comp_plans_pkg
81    PROCEDURE DELETE_RECORD (
82       x_quota_id                          NUMBER,
83       x_name                              VARCHAR2
84    );
85 
86 
87 END cn_quotas_pkg;